What is the highest paying scrap metal?

What is the highest paying scrap metal?

For many scrappers, copper is king because of the consistently high value it can generate. The prices paid to scrappers for copper scrap, such as tubes and wire, can command between $2 and $4 per pound, which is significantly higher than other kinds of base metal.

What is heavy copper?

Heavy Copper is defined as having layers of copper weighing more than 3 Ounces. It can often be found on things like circuit boards. It must consist of a minimum of 98% Copper. It is a lot heavier and more subsantial than its other Copper counterparts, and has a variety of uses.

Why is scrap steel so high?

One of the other reasons that we have seen scrap steel prices increasing has been the increased pricing on iron ore, which means it’s more expensive to pull it out of the ground than it is to recycle it, and with 70% of the steel in this country being recycled and reused instead of mined, we have seen the prices …

Are scrap copper prices rising?

Copper Scrap Prices May be On The Rise (Supply vs Demand)

For copper, a major supply gap of over 8 million tons from now through 2030 is currently foreshadowed. With that being said, copper prices have risen by nearly 80% in 2021, and it does not look like the climb is slowing down anytime soon.

What is unclean brass?

Dirty brass generally has foreign contaminants such as paint, oil, and other metals. Glass and wood can also cause your brass to be considered as dirty. If there is copper attached to your brass materials, this generally does not cause it to be qualified as dirty.

Why is scrap iron prices going up?

Global scrap prices trend up amid anticipated shortages in supply, strong demand for downstream steel. Global steel scrap markets have seen higher prices in the past week because of an expected reduction in volumes of supply out of Russia and stronger demand for downstream steel products.

How long will steel prices stay high?

In March 2020, prior to the COVID-19 pandemic, steel prices traded between $500 and $800. The price of steel as of July 2021 is up over 200%, trading at $1,800, and many involved in the market don’t see the price reducing until at least 2022.

Why is steel so expensive right now?

The demand for the steel is soaring, but the demand for iron ore is in decline. A number of factors account for the high prices of steel futures—among them, tariffs imposed by the Trump administration on imported steel, and the pent-up demand in manufacturing after the pandemic.

Is steel still rising?

Demand is increasing throughout the world, including North America, according to the World Steel Association, where use was up 13.7% from 2020 to 2021 and is projected to jump another 5.4% in 2022.
